The Buildbase CCM team of Stephen Sword and Tom Church, together with the Cosworth Utag Yamaha UK squad of American Zach Osborne and British Teenager, Mel Pocock have withdrawn from other events in recent weeks, specifically to prepare for this major event. They will also be joined by the CAS Honda squad of Russian Evgeny Bobreshev and South African, Gareth Swanepoel, whilst the HM Plant Red Bull team of Jake Nicholls and Graeme Irwin will challenge for the top spot. Current MX1 champion, Jordie Brad Anderson, will also be there with his hard riding style.

Timed Training starts at 9.30am, with the first of six championship races at 12.30pm. Race fans can also view some Club Road Racing on the tarmac circuit free of charge and the motocross event has a MXY2 (Youth) support class of two races. The riders will all be available to everyone for an Autograph session at approx 11.35am.

Admission prices are pegged at £20 for adults and £5 for children with a family ticket costing just £45. Mallory Park is easily reached from the M6, M1, M69 and M42 motorways, which will make it a must for a day of motorcycle action.
